When Cube says "You done run 100 miles but you still got 1 to go" he is talking about the song NWA made when he left, called 100 Miles and Runnin. When he says 'you still got 1 to go' he means that when a prisoner is on death row and about to be given the death penalty, he is referring to the perceived distance the prisoner has to walk from their cell to the death chamber. Like in the move The Green Mile. So he is saying Dre, Ren, Eazy and Yella are going to be killed.
